Summary

Mosquito and Other Biting Flies category includes the use of insecticides into water or on/over land, by ground application only, for the control of mosquitoes and other biting flies. It includes control of all stages (egg, larvae, pupae and adults) of mosquitoes and other biting flies. The knowledge requirements described in this module are additional to the knowledge requirements detailed in the Applicator Core (will be referred in the main text as "the Core") common to all certification categories. This module adds details to sections in the Core, where it is necessary to include Mosquito and Other Biting Flies specific information. An outline of the knowledge requirement for the Mosquito and Other Biting Flies Module is presented on the following page. This outline shows which sections of the Core have been expanded in the module.
